Configuring IP-Based TDF Subscriber Setup When Router Is a RADIUS Server
This task describes how to configure IP-based TDF subscriber setup when the gateway GPRS support node (GGSN), Packet Data Network Gateway (PGW), or broadband network gateway (BNG) identifies the router as a RADIUS server. An IP-based TDF subscriber is defined by the AVP values in the RADIUS accounting request received.
Before you configure the subscriber setup, you must do the following:
Configure the access interfaces on the router chassis.
Configure the PCEF profile.
Configure the interface and IP address that you want to receive RADIUS requests on the router.
Configure a TDF gateway.
